25 aniversario

Este año, 2017, ha sido muy importante para nuestro negocio. En 1992, Barcelona fue elegida como la ciudad para celebrar los juegos olímpicos. Pero esto, no solo significaba que muchos deportistas de élite viajaran a una ciudad como Barcelona para demostrar sus dotes. Sino que, este hecho, hizo que la ciudad se modernizara y mejorara.  Se mejoro el aeropuerto, se restauro la villa olímpica, se crearon nuevos hoteles, se construyeron nuevas instalaciones deportivas y se amplio la red viaria de Barcelona. Las olimpiadas tuvieron el efecto de sacar de la oscuridad a la ciudad para vestirla con su mejor traje de luces. Este año y los consecutivos fueron increíbles para Barcelona y bien lo saben los que estuvieron allí para verlo y disfrutarlo.

Fue esto, lo que empujo a muchos emprendedores a lanzarse abriendo sus nuevos negocios. Y por ello, este año 2017 estamos de celebración dado que, en 1992 se abrieron las puertas de esta peluquería. Han sido 25 años de aventuras, de cambios, de ilusiones, de entusiasmo y alegría. 25 años conociendo a clientes, algunos nuevos y otros veteranos. Pero clientes a los que se les coge aprecio por el hecho de compartir un rato con los empleados. 25 años donde hay compañeros de trabajos des de los inicios, otros nuevos y de otros que marcharon, pero que cada uno de ellos tiene guardados en su mente la peluquería como una época maravillosa. Gracias a todos, a clientes y a trabajadores hemos hecho posible que hoy podamos celebrar este 25 años con la peluquería abierta. Gracias por confiar en este proyecto. Las olimpiadas cambiaron la ciudad de Barcelona y también la vida de muchas personas.

FIRA DEL COMERÇ 2017

El sábado día 27 de mayo los comerciantes de la zona sacamos nuestros puestos a la calle para favorecer el comercio de proximidad en el barrio de la Vila Olímpica. Panaderías, tiendas de ropa, guarderías…Y como no, nuestra peluquería. La gente que paseaba por avenida Bogatell pudo comprar nuestros productos, hacerse un cambio de look con un toque de planchas ghd y participar en un sorteo valorado en mas de 50€. Pero además, pudieron disfrutar de un desfile disfrutando de peinados, maquillajes, manicuras y pedicuras realizadas por nuestra peluquería combinada con outfits de otra tienda del barrio llamada «Entre dos».

Celebración 15 años I.C.O.N

Los anteriores días 5 y 6 de Marzo del 2017, la peluquería Angela Montero Perruquers asistió al evento organizado por I.C.O.N. La marca de productos profesionales se caracteriza por la variedad que dispone para adaptarse a todo tipo de cabellos. Dichos productos son utilizados en nuestra peluquería desde hace años para ofrecer el cuidado que requiere cada persona.

I.C.O.N organizó un evento a lo grande para celebrar su 15 aniversario y esta fiesta no dejó indiferente a nadie. Madrid fue el sitio elegido para reunir a 2.500 peluqueros de todo el mundo y así disfrutar de lo que mas nos gusta, gracias a unos espectáculos llenos de una gran inspiración.

How to Buy Products for Your Salon

Retail sales are an important revenue stream for almost any salon or spa. Just as important as choosing the right.

Retail sales are an important revenue stream for almost any salon or spa. Just as important as choosing the right retail line to sell is learning the best, least expensive ways to buy products for your salon.

Your first step in buying products for your salon or day spa is to choose a brand that you love. You want a brand that not only matches the look and feel of your salon, but that your stylists and technicians are comfortable using. Clients are much more likely to buy a product if they’ve just had a good experience with that product at your salon. Unfortunately, not all brands will work with all salons. In order to protect the integrity of their brand, some brands have stringent rules about which salons are allowed to sell their product.
